We visited Ye Old New Inn for the second time today and were disappointed that they were once again not serving food at lunchtime. We went a couple of months ago to find they were not serving food at lunchtime as they were finding it difficult to get a chef. They were only serving food in the evening. Their web site said they were serving lunch but this was incorrect. Yesterday we messaged them to ask if they were doing food at lunchtime today, and were reassured that the full lunch menu would be available. The web site also stated that lunch was served. We made a special trip to find that they were having problems getting a chef and there was no food available once again. We will not visit Ye Old New Inn again, but today we went to the nearby Harbour Inn and had a delicious meal. We will certainly return to The Harbour Inn.

Called in for Sunday lunch yesterday. They offer a carvery lunch. When we approached the bar there were 3 members of staff behind it. No one gave us any eye contact and we waited for a long time until they acknowledged us. I appreciate they were busy but did not appreciate the older woman behind the bar serving two locals who actually arrived a considerable amount of time after us before serving us! The carvery was well, ok ish...the yorkshire puddings were limp and the beef over cooked. The vegetables were inedible as they were cooked to death. I thought the price they were charging was not value for money. Sadly I think we will not be returning any time soon.

Dined here on Sunday and throughly enjoyed our carvery. Well organised with no queuing. Choice of three meats and a good selection of vegetables. We were given good portions of meat. We sat in the “conservatory” room at the back with plenty of windows to look out of onto the countryside. We would definitely go back for the roast and also try their main menu on another day as Sunday is Carvery day.
